Typical pet sitting and walking prices in Springfield, MA (USD, 2026) — low to high per job
JobTypical range (USD)Unit
Drop-in visit (30 min)$20–$35per visit
Dog walk (30 min)$20–$30per visit
Overnight sitting (sitter's home)$70–$140per night
Full-day care (multiple visits, meds, playtime)$30–$95per day
Vacation week (2 visits/day)$270–$470per job

Estimates: typical US ranges adjusted for Springfield's regional price level (about 4% below the national average; BEA Regional Price Parities 2024, all items, Springfield MA MSA, divided by 100). Get two or three quotes for your exact job.

What's different about pet sitting and walking in Springfield

In Springfield, MA, pet care plans need to account for a real four-season routine. January normal daily lows average 18.8°F, while July normal daily highs average 85.2°F; annual snowfall averages 51.7 inches, and frequent freeze-thaw cycles, occasional ice storms, and nor’easters can complicate walk timing and key handoffs. For Forest Park or East Forest Park visits, give the sitter clear instructions for weather changes, indoor exercise, feeding, medications, and how to reach you if a scheduled walk needs adjustment.

Springfield’s older housing stock makes a detailed home-access plan especially useful. Forty-one percent of units were built before 1940, and much of the city consists of single-family homes or duplexes, including brick Victorian duplexes and triple-deckers. In Sixteen Acres, Indian Orchard, or McKnight, confirm the exact entrance, key or lockbox procedure, pet supplies, and any stairs or unit-specific instructions. Pet sitting and dog walking are largely unlicensed trades, so prioritize an insured, bonded sitter with pet first-aid certification; overnight in-home care warrants background checks, references, and careful key handling.

Best time to book in Springfield

July and August are peak vacation season and holiday weekends also surge; book 3-4 weeks ahead in busy cities for summer or major holidays. Peak demand: July and August. Typical job length: 30 min per visit; overnight jobs run nightly; a vacation-coverage job typically spans 5-7 days.

DIY or pro? A trusted neighbor or friend can informally cover feeding/walks for short trips, but hire an insured, background-checked professional for overnight stays, medication administration, or trips longer than a few days.

How much does pet sitting cost in Springfield, MA?

A 30-minute drop-in visit typically runs $20–$35 per visit, while full-day care with multiple visits, medications, and playtime is $30–$100 per day. Extra pets, special-needs care, longer visits, holidays, and insured professional care can increase the total.

When should I book a dog walker in Springfield, MA for a summer trip?

July and August are peak vacation months, and holiday weekends also surge. For summer or major holidays in busy cities, book 3–4 weeks ahead and give the sitter a complete schedule for visits, walks, feeding, medications, and emergency contacts.

Do pet sitters in Massachusetts need a license or permit?

Pet sitting and dog walking are largely unlicensed trades in the United States and Canada. Springfield’s building-permit process concerns construction work, so focus instead on liability insurance or bonding, pet first-aid certification, references, background checks, and secure key handling for overnight care.
